The #7 Porsche Penske Motorsport car secured a historic third-straight win in the Daytona 24 Hours, fending off a late charge by Jack Aitken.

The race was significantly affected by a six-and-a-half-hour suspension due to heavy fog over Daytona, with the #7 crew of Felipe Nasr, Julien Andlauer, and Laurin Heinrich leading during this period.

In the final hour, Nasr held off Aitken’s aggressive attempts to overtake in the #31 Cadillac Whelen, securing the victory for Porsche.

The #24 BMW and the #6 Porsche 963 rounded out the top four positions, with Porsche claiming its 21st Daytona 24 Hours win.

Nasr’s role in securing all three consecutive wins for the #7 crew solidifies his status among elite drivers in sports car racing.

Following Porsche’s victory, it was mentioned that the team would no longer compete in the World Endurance Championship and at Le Mans 24 Hours.
